body{min-width:1200px;}
.fl{float:left;}
.fr{float:right;}
.mr0{margin-right:0 !important;}
.top-menu a:hover{text-decoration:underline;}

.wrapper{width:1200px;margin:0 auto;}
.header{padding-top:249px;background:url(../img/header_bg.jpg) no-repeat top center;}
.header .wrapper{position:relative;}
.top-menu{position:absolute;top:0;left:0;width:100%;font-size:14px;}
.top-menu .menu-left{float:left;padding:14px 0 0 30px;}
.top-menu .menu-left *{margin:0 6px;}
.top-menu .menu-left .welcome-tip{color:#fff;}
.top-menu .menu-left a{color:#ffbf66;}
.top-menu .menu-right{float:right;padding:14px 14px 0;}
.top-menu .menu-right li{float:left;}
.top-menu .menu-right a{color:#fff;margin:0 14px;}

.nav ul{padding:0 12px;border-radius:28px 28px 0 0;background:#cc1e14 url(../img/right_corner_bg.png) no-repeat right top;}
.nav li{float:left;margin:0 30px;}
.nav a{position:relative;display:block;height:60px;line-height:60px;font-size:18px;color:#fff;padding:0 14px;}
.nav a:hover,.nav a.active{font-weight:bold;}
.nav a:hover:after,.nav a.active:after{position:absolute;bottom:8px;left:0;width:100%;height:4px;content:'';border-radius:2px;background:#ffbf66;}

/*.footer{height:278px;background:#484848;}*/
/*.footer .wrapper{position:relative;padding-top:30px;overflow:hidden;}*/
/*.footer-main{height:216px;padding-left:80px;border-left:1px solid #666;margin-left:276px;}*/
/*.footer-qr-code{float:left;padding:28px 0 0 70px;}*/
/*.footer-qr-code .qr-code-img{width:126px;height:126px;background:url(../img/qr_code_bg.png) no-repeat;}*/
/*.footer-qr-code .qr-code-desc{font-size:14px;color:#fff;text-align:center;margin-top:10px;}*/
/*.site-name{font-size:20px;color:#8c8c8c;padding-top:30px;}*/
/*.site-other{padding-top:24px;}*/
/*.site-other-item{float:left;width:50%;}*/
/*.site-other-item p{height:28px;line-height:28px;font-size:14px;color:#8c8c8c;}*/

.footer{min-height:380px;background:url(../img/footer_bg.jpg) no-repeat;background-size:100% 100%;}
.footer .content-box{padding-top:90px;overflow:hidden;}
.footer .box-left{float:left;padding-left:40px;}
.footer .box-left .logo{width:179px;height:135px;background:url(../img/logo2.png) no-repeat;background-size:100% 100%;}
.footer .box-right{float:left;padding-left:38px;}
.footer .box-right .content-row:nth-child(1){font-size:24px;color:#fff;padding-top:16px;}
.footer .box-right .content-row:nth-child(2){line-height:24px;font-size:18px;color:#fff;padding-top:24px;}
.footer .footer-menu-wrapper{padding-top:115px;overflow:hidden;}
.footer .footer-menu{float:right;}
.footer .footer-menu ul{padding-right:80px;}
.footer .footer-menu li{padding:3px}
.footer .footer-menu a{font-size:18px;color:#fff;font-weight:bold;}
.footer .bottom-info{padding-top:50px;}
.footer .copyright{line-height:30px;font-size:18px;color:#fff;}
.footer .footer-links{font-size:18px;color:#fff;padding:2px 0 20px;}
.footer .footer-links a{color:#fff;}